Rishi Sunak, who will officially become the Prime Minister of the UK today, is the sixth Indian origin to hold the top position globally
He is also the first non-white to be elected as the PM of the UK
Born in 1980 in an Indian family in Southampton, Sunak has been a Member of Parliament since 2015
He first served as Chief Secretary of the Treasury from 2019 to 2020 and then as Chancellor of the Exchequer from 2020 to 2022
Apart from Rishi, there are other leaders of the Indian diaspora who are holding top posts in governments across the globe
Antonio Costa is the present Prime Minster of Portugal and he assumed office as on November 26, 2015
Mohammed Irfaan Ali is the current and first-ever Muslim President of Guyana
The Prime Minister of Mauritius - Pravind Jugnauth - is the son of Anerood Jugnauth, who served as former President and Prime Minister of Mauritius
Prithvirajsing Roopun was elected as the seventh President of Mauritius in 2019
Indian-origin Chandrikapersad Santokhi, who assumed office on July 1, 2020, is the ninth President of Suriname
